During the Telophase, the daughter chromosomes reach the poles. Telophase passes into the next interphase as the nuclear envelopes and the nucleoli re-form and the chromatin becomes diffuse.
On the other hand, remember that cytokinesis starts during the nuclear division phase called anaphase and continues through telophase. Cytokinesis is the physical process of cell division, which divides the cytoplasm of a parental cell into two daughter cells.

The unique pattern of DNA fragment distribution when separated by gel electrophoresis is referred to as what?
The unique pattern of DNA fragment distribution when separated by gel electrophoresis is referred to as a DNA fingerprint or DNA profile.
Gel electrophoresis is a technique used to separate DNA fragments based on their size and charge. In this process, DNA samples are loaded onto a gel matrix and subjected to an electric field, causing the DNA fragments to migrate through the gel.
The migration of DNA fragments through the gel results in the formation of distinct bands or patterns. These patterns are unique to each individual and can be visualized as a series of dark bands of varying lengths. The pattern of bands represents the distribution of DNA fragments within the sample.
This unique pattern of DNA fragment distribution is often referred to as a DNA fingerprint or DNA profile. It serves as a molecular signature specific to an individual and can be used for various purposes, including forensic identification, paternity testing, and genetic analysis.

the only known regulatory mechanism for pyruvate carboxylase is
The only known regulatory mechanism for pyruvate carboxylase is allosteric activation by acetyl-CoA.
Pyruvate carboxylase is an enzyme involved in the metabolic pathway known as gluconeogenesis, where it plays a crucial role in the conversion of pyruvate into oxaloacetate. This enzyme is regulated by several factors, but the only known regulatory mechanism is allosteric activation by acetyl-CoA.
Acetyl-CoA is a molecule formed during the breakdown of carbohydrates, fats, and proteins. It serves as a key regulator of pyruvate carboxylase activity by binding to the enzyme and enhancing its catalytic function. When acetyl-CoA levels are high, it signals the need for increased gluconeogenesis to produce glucose for energy.
The binding of acetyl-CoA to pyruvate carboxylase induces conformational changes in the enzyme's structure, leading to an increase in its catalytic activity. This allosteric activation allows pyruvate carboxylase to effectively convert pyruvate into oxaloacetate, facilitating the continuation of gluconeogenesis.

how do all viruses differ from bacteria?
All viruses differ from bacteria in the sense that viruses cannot reproduce outside of a living host but bacteria can.
What are viruses and bacteria?Virus is a submicroscopic, non-cellular structure consisting of a genetic material (DNA or RNA) surrounded by a protein coat called capsid.
A bacterium cell, on the other hand, is a single celled organism with cell walls but no nucleus or organelles.
A virus requires a living host cell to replicate while a bacterium can replicate itself irrespective of a living host.
